Summary

MANTECHseeks a motivated, career-focusedProject Close Out Managerto join our team inChantilly, VA.In this role, you will ensure all project deliverables, documentation, financial reconciliations, and administrative requirements are completed accurately and in accordance with customer and organizational standards. The Project Close Out Manager also manages the project assignment queue, ensuring projects are reviewed, prioritized, and assigned to Project Managers in a timely manner to support operational efficiency and customer expectations.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Manage the end-to-end project closeout process from Team Lead review through final project closure.
  • Monitor project and resource management dashboards to ensure work locations have sufficient personnel, equipment, and resources available to successfully execute assigned projects and meet schedule commitments.
  • Review project documentation, deliverables, financial records, and required approvals to ensure projects meet closure requirements.
  • Ensure all project closeout activities are completed accurately, on time, and in compliance with customer and organizational standards.
  • Manage and monitor the project assignment queue, ensuring projects are assigned to Project Managers in a timely and efficient manner.
  • Coordinate with leadership to balance project workloads and align assignments with available resources and skillsets.
  • Support customer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) as required by the program.
  • Provide local travel support between customer buildings or temporary assignments to alternate locations for special projects.
  • Work an 8-hours shift within a coverage team operating between 6:00 AM and 6:00 PM.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• High School Diploma with 8+ years of experience or an associate?s degree with 6+ years of experience, or a bachelor?s degree with 4+ years of experience.
  • Demonstrated experience managing project lifecycles, including project closeout activities and administrative project controls.
  • Experience managing project intake, prioritization, and assignment processes.
  • Direct knowledge of the customer?s operational environment, including ticketing systems, installations, desktop technologies, corporate applications, access administration, and voice/video infrastructure.
  • Demonstrated experience managing projects in a Working Capital Fund (WCF) environment.
  • Proven ability to build and maintain constructive relationships with customers, stakeholders, technical teams, and contractors.
  • Ability to clearly understand and discuss project statuses and offer practical solutions to issues.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• PMP, Scrum Master, or equivalent project management certification.
  • Direct knowledge of the customer?s operational environment, including ticketing systems, desktop technologies, corporate applications, access administration, and voice/video infrastructure.
  • Strong communication skills to effectively collaborate with co-workers, management, and customers; must be able to exchange accurate information.
  • Ability to adapt to rapidly changing tasks and requirements while learning new skills quickly on the job.

Clearance Requirements:

  • Must have a current/active TS/SCI with Polygraph.

Physical Requirements:

  • Must be able to remain in a stationary position at least 50% of the time.
  • Must be able to operate a computer, phone, and other office equipment for extended periods.
  • Must be able to move/traverse within and between buildings and offices, position self to maintain equipment and cabling (including under desks, moving floor tiles, and in server closets, some of which may be confined spaces).
  • Must be able to move Audio/Visual or Computer equipment weighing 50+ pounds; some equipment may require team-lift or use of carts.
  • Must be able to ascend/descend a ladder (10+ feet high) while pulling cables and adjusting equipment.
